Georgia Ports Authority

Georgia Ports Authority (GPA) operates the ports of Savannah and Brunswick, which are among the busiest in the United States. They facilitate international trade by handling cargo such as containers, automobiles, and bulk commodities. GPA generates revenue through port fees, terminal services, and logistics solutions. Established in 1945, GPA has significantly expanded its infrastructure and capabilities, making it a vital economic engine for Georgia and the southeastern U.S. The authority is known for its strategic investments in technology and sustainability to enhance operational efficiency and environmental stewardship.
